Which deluxe to choose depends somewhat on which theme parks you want to focus on your time in WDW. Both of my children opted to spend their honeymoons in an Epcot area resort. (ETA: they both chose the Dolphin for the savings. It is worth considering.) Many young people like the access to dining in Epcot (requires park hopper tickets), the night activities in the area, the walking or boat access to both Epcot and DHS, the central location and the slightly lower prices than the MK resorts.
For an Epcot area honeymoon in April, I would recommend either the YC or the BWI. The YC has access to Stormalong Bay, which is a really nice swimming pool. It would be a nice place to spend the day. Of course, the BWI has an exciting pool area as well. but the clown face slide is more 'fun' than romantic, at best, and somewhat creepy at worst. BWI does have a quiet pool that is very nice though. I would suggest YC over BC for you because almost all rooms have full size balconies there and there is generally a more adult atmosphere at the YC.
If the castle and the Magic Kingdom are a big attraction for you, then the MK resorts are all awesome. (In fact, I personally think that they are the most romantic of all. But I am a sucker for castles and fantasy!) Perhaps the most romantic is the Poly. The lit tiki torches at night, the beautiful tropical atmosphere, the relaxing music, the view of the castle, the large comfortable rooms and the awesome dining options all combine to make a resort that people consistently love at all ages. The Poly rooms have easy direct monorail access to both Epcot (walk to TTC) and the MK (from GCH). Also the Poly has a really nice boat ride to the MK (shared with the GF). I find it really difficult to pick a favourite overall WDW resort, but the Poly would probably win if I were forced to choose one. It is very busy, though, and a lot of families choose this resort.
Second MK area choice would be the Grand Floridian. It is beautiful and has an elegance to it that is very special. Finally, there is the Animal Kingdom Lodge. It is so exotic with lots of animals to watch from your balcony. The dining here is incredible and the two pools are both awesome. The rooms re smaller, but very comfortable and significantly less expensive than most of the other deluxe resorts. If you want to feel like you are in another world when you leave the theme parks, this is a great option. Also, note that the pool view rooms are less expensive than savanna view rooms but have really pretty views of the pool area, so that could be a good budget option. There are lots of public viewing area to see the animals throughout the resort.
I would take a look online at pictures of the resorts. Decide upon the theme that appeals to you the most and consider which theme parks you will want the most access to while on that portion of your trip. Then choose the one that makes you both happy.
